YACHT RALLY THROUGH BIMP-EAGA SEAS THIS YEAR
From Newmond Tibin
PAMPANGA (Philippines), March 26 (Bernama) -- Yacht owners and crew together
with key tourism players from the Brunei-Indonesia-Malaysia-Philippines East
Asean Growth Area (BIMP-EAGA) will embark on a yacht rally this year to promote
community-based tourism in the region.
Dubbed as "Sail BIMP-EAGA: Exploring Equator Asia", the yacht rally is not
only targeted for cruising yacht owners and crew, but will also benefit tourism
associations, venues and attractions, and local communities across BIMP-EAGA.
A statement issued by the Mindanao Economic Development Council said the
event would also present opportunities for regional tourism stakeholders from
both private and public sectors to highlight their tourist attractions and
services and in bringing tourism income direct to local communities and small
and medium enterprises.
"We aim to capitalise on the self-sufficient nature of cruising yachts to
bring visitors to venues in BIMP-EAGA," said Allan Riches, an executive member
of the association of travel agents in Brunei and organiser of the event, in the
statement.
He said that in the short term, the rally yachts would themselves buy
travel-related products and services in the places they stop.
"In the long term, the publicity and awareness they create among yacht
owners, via their yacht websites and blogs, travel magazine articles, will
magnify the number of visiting yachts way beyond the numbers we expect to have
in the actual rallies," Riches added.
The rally routes and stops in the Philippines would be developed based on
recommendations from the local tourism councils who would identify venues,
attractions, tours that would be promoted, he said.
The yacht rally was adopted as a key element in the joint tourism
development marketing strategy during a BIMP-EAGA Strategic Planning Workshop in
November 2009 in Kota Kinabalu and an outcome of the BIMP-EAGA Business Council
Sustainable Community-based Ecotourism Conference in October-November 2008 in
Manado, Indonesia.
Exact dates for various events are still being finalised and will be
available soon on www.bruneibay.net/bimp-eagarally.
